Output 2a958198612ee951dbbf297c6c9cf2311cf47da1668afcb6e770220bfc0e2b79:0

value
21141682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687a0b4cd371daea7965b13958fc6561d11293b8 OP_EQUAL
address
3BDSQGbWbKssdFU8i7g7zKKHiuRvNgAfdx
transaction
2a958198612ee951dbbf297c6c9cf2311cf47da1668afcb6e770220bfc0e2b79
spent
true